GiampieroSilvestri Posted April 17, 2021 Share Posted April 17, 2021 I built this a couple of years ago.The first project of the Aermacchi MB326 trainer aircraft had the seats side by side.As there is only one drawing of the aircraft this is my interpretation of it.It is the Italeri (ex-Esci) 1/48 scale kit combined with the nose of a Trumpeter AT-37.
